The characteristics of galvanized hexagonal net: easy to use; Save transportation costs. It can be shrunk into small rolls and involved in moisture-proof paper packaging, taking up little space. Coating thickness uniformity, stronger corrosion resistance; The construction is simple and does not require special technology; Strong resistance to natural damage and corrosion resistance and adverse weather effects; Can withstand a large range of deformation, and still not collapse. It has the function of fixed heat preservation and insulation.
Galvanized hexagonal mesh uses: building wall fixed, heat preservation, heat insulation; Power plant piping, boiler heating; Anti-freezing, residential protection, landscaping protection; Raise chicken and duck, isolate chicken and duck house, play the role of protecting poultry; Protect and support seawalls, hillsides, roads and Bridges and other waterworks.

The pH of wastewater can significantly influence the effectiveness of various treatment processes. To optimize conditions for biological treatment or to facilitate coagulation, plants often use chemicals to adjust the pH. Commonly employed substances for pH adjustment include sodium hydroxide (caustic soda) and sulfuric acid. Maintaining an appropriate pH range is vital for both the biological treatment processes and the overall efficiency of the chemical treatments applied.

Colorants, including pigments and dyes, enhance the aesthetics of plastic products. They can provide vibrant colors, improve opaqueness, and even impart special effects such as metallic or pearlescent finishes. The choice of colorant depends on the desired application and the properties of the base polymer. For example, certain pigments are designed to withstand UV light to prevent fading and maintain the product's appearance over time.

PQQ is a redox cofactor and a powerful antioxidant found in various foods, including fermented soybeans, spinach, and green pepper. It plays a critical role in cellular metabolism and energy production by supporting mitochondrial function. Mitochondria, often referred to as the powerhouses of the cell, are responsible for generating adenosine triphosphate (ATP), the primary energy currency in our body. PQQ enhances mitochondrial biogenesis, meaning it encourages the production of new mitochondria, which is crucial for improving cellular energy and function.
Quality control (QC) and assurance (QA) are integral components of the API production process. Regulatory bodies such as the FDA in the United States and the EMA in Europe impose strict guidelines to ensure that APIs are manufactured in compliance with Good Manufacturing Practices (GMP). These guidelines dictate everything from raw material selection to final product testing. Rigorous testing methods, including High-Performance Liquid Chromatography (HPLC) and Mass Spectrometry (MS), are employed to analyze the quality, potency, and purity of the API. Quality assurance procedures help in maintaining consistent production standards and ensuring compliance with regulatory requirements.

One of the most notable applications of sodium thiocyanate is its role as a reagent in chemical synthesis. It is frequently utilized in organic chemistry for the preparation of thiocyanate derivatives, which are essential in producing various organic compounds. The nucleophilic properties of thiocyanate make it an effective agent in substitution reactions, where it can replace halides in organic molecules. This property is valuable in synthesizing agrochemicals and pharmaceuticals, where specific functional groups are necessary to impart desired biological activities.

Polyacrylamide (PAM) is a synthetic polymer widely used as a flocculant in various industrial processes. Its ability to bind particles together and enhance the settling of solids makes it a vital component in water treatment, wastewater management, and other applications where the clarification of suspensions is necessary.

- Compared to more aggressive descalers, such as hydrochloric acid, sulphamic acid is relatively safer to handle. It produces fewer hazardous fumes, reducing the risk of inhalation injuries. Additionally, sulphamic acid is less corrosive, making it suitable for use on various materials such as stainless steel, aluminum, and plastics. This characteristic not only protects the equipment but also minimizes the environmental impact, as it can often be neutralized and disposed of with fewer environmental concerns.
